I have a 45 HP Mahindra 4510. The MWFD just quick working. The 4wd lever will go forward and backward (on and off) and the lever moves but the MFWD is not functioning. The only thing I did differently was tighten up the jam/lock nuts on the clutch and brake rods. Both had the correct amount of freeplay but the jam nuts were not tight at all.
I could live with this except I have hilly, wet ground. Pulling logs up the hill is OK due to the weight on the rear. Going downhill I have to be careful as it wants to gain speed or free wheel and have to use the front end loader to keep speeds from getting to great. Also any backing up on a slight incline or in too wet an area and I am nearly stuck without the front wheel assist.
The unit seems to be mechanical, levers and rods to function, no fuse or electronics involved that I can tell as compared to the PTO.
I am getting by but am careful and would have a lot more success in pulling and general use if the MFWD functioned. Any thoughts/cures? I will use a flashlight tomorrow to make sure nothing is impeding the rods/levers of the unit. Thanks
